#10FABF Hex Color Code

#10FABF

The Hexadecimal Color #10FABF is a contrast shade of Medium Spring Green. #10FABF RGB value is rgb(16, 250, 191). RGB Color Model of #10FABF consists of 6% red, 98% green and 74% blue. HSL color Mode of #10FABF has 165°(degrees) Hue, 96% Saturation and 52% Lightness. #10FABF color has an wavelength of 516.11111n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#10FABF is #33FFCC.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#10FABF is #1FB. The Closest Color to #10FABF is #00FA9A. Official Name of #10FABF Hex Code is Caribbean Green.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#10FABF is 94 Cyan 0 Magenta 24 Yellow 2 Black and #10FABF CMY is 94, 0, 24.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#10FABF is hsl(165,96,52,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(165, 94, 98).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#10FABF is 43.8, 72.24, 60.91.
Hex8 Value of #10FABF is #10FABFFF. Decimal Value of #10FABF is 1112767 and Octal Value of #10FABF is 4175277. Binary Value of #10FABF is 10000, 11111010, 10111111 and Android of #10FABF is 4279302847 / 0xff10fabf.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#10FABF is 0.248, 0.408, 0.408 and YIQ Color Space of #10FABF is 173.308, -120.4839, -67.8518.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#10FABF is 53.24, 92.18, 61.01.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#10FABF is 88.08, -62.44, 14.66.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#10FABF is 88.08, -73.41, 31.95.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#10FABF is 88.08, 64.14, 166.79. Hunter Lab variable of #10FABF is 84.99, -56.75, 17.01.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#10FABF

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
